How Does Physical Therapy Actually Help?

Physical therapy is one of the most effective and best-researched ways to treat pain and injury without relying on medication or surgery. Here is how it works.

It restores movement and function. Injury and pain make you move less, which leads to stiffness and weakness that make the problem worse. Therapy breaks that cycle by safely rebuilding your range of motion and strength.

It reduces pain naturally. Through manual therapy, targeted exercise, and modalities like heat, ice, and electrical stimulation, physical therapy lowers pain without the side effects of long-term medication.

It prevents the problem from returning. This is the part medication cannot do. By correcting the underlying weakness, imbalance, or movement pattern, therapy lowers your risk of the same injury happening again.

It helps you avoid surgery. For many conditions, a course of physical therapy resolves the problem well enough that surgery is never needed.

What Happens at Your First Visit?

Knowing what to expect makes that first appointment a lot less stressful. Here is how it works at our West Windsor clinic.

Step 1: Comprehensive Evaluation

Your therapist starts by listening. We ask about your symptoms, when they started, what makes them better or worse, and how they affect your daily life. Then we perform a hands-on assessment of your movement, strength, flexibility, and the specific area causing trouble.

Step 2: Your Personalized Plan

Based on the evaluation, we build a treatment plan tailored to your diagnosis and your goals, whether that is returning to a sport, getting through a workday pain-free, or recovering after surgery.

Step 3: Active Treatment

Your sessions combine hands-on care, guided exercise, and advanced treatments as needed. Just as important, we teach you a simple home program so your progress continues between visits.

Step 4: Progress and Prevention

We track your improvement and adjust your plan as you heal. As you near your goals, we shift the focus toward prevention, giving you the tools to stay strong and avoid re-injury.

How Long Will It Take to Feel Better?

Recovery time depends on your condition, but most patients begin noticing improvement within the first two to four weeks of consistent therapy. Simple strains and acute injuries often resolve within a few weeks, while post-surgical recovery or chronic conditions can take longer.

The biggest factors in how quickly you recover are starting early, attending your sessions consistently, and doing your home exercises. Patients who follow their full plan almost always recover faster than those who stop as soon as the pain eases.

Frequently Asked Questions

Do I need a referral to start physical therapy in West Windsor? In most cases you can begin directly through direct access, though some insurance plans require a doctor's referral. Our team checks your specific benefits and lets you know before your first visit.

Will my insurance cover physical therapy? Most insurance plans cover physical therapy. We verify your exact benefits up front so you know what is covered before you start, with no surprises.

How many visits will I need? It depends on your condition. Many patients attend two to three visits per week early on, then taper down as they improve. Your therapist gives you a realistic estimate after your evaluation.

What should I wear to my appointment? Wear comfortable, loose clothing that lets you move easily and gives your therapist access to the area being treated. Athletic wear and sneakers work well.

Can physical therapy help me avoid surgery? In many cases, yes. For a wide range of conditions, a course of physical therapy resolves the problem well enough that surgery becomes unnecessary. We always aim for the least invasive path to recovery.
